Biosolids Seminar
Every two years, the FWEA Biosolids Committee works in conjunction with the Seminars Committee to host a biosolids seminar. Recognized experts from EPA, FDEP, various universities, the consulting industry, and local utilities have presented at past seminars. Topics include regulatory updates, national perspectives on biosolids management, technology trends, land application and nutrient management planning, biosolids management strategies, and case studies.
